Need Help? The SAMHSA National Helpline Provides Support

The SAMHSA National Helpline is a toll-free service available 24/7 to individuals and families experiencing with mental health or substance use concerns. This valuable resource connects individuals with trained assistants who can offer support, recommendations to local treatment options, and details about available resources.

Whether be a mental health crisis, the SAMHSA National Helpline can provide urgent help.
